
Illya
13.02.2017
11:30:02
просто чтоб писать на высокоуровневом JS эффективно - лучше таки понимать парадигму DOM / BOM

Emil
13.02.2017
11:30:19
там действительно, судя по всему, тупо нет конфигурации для загрузки видео

Андрей
13.02.2017
11:30:49

Google

Андрей
13.02.2017
11:31:13
У меня впечатление что vue умеет работать только с одним элементом

Illya
13.02.2017
11:31:48
vue таким не занимается :) в jquery для этого есть синтаксис в три аргумента .on
В чистом JS - вешаетесь на контейнер и проверяете event.target
помойму проще дерево свернуть. Оно одним reduce сворачивается

Андрей
13.02.2017
11:33:23
Что значит свернуть дерево?

Illya
13.02.2017
11:34:14
ну превратить его из nested sets на стороне клиента в нормальное дерево

Андрей
13.02.2017
11:34:14
Подгружать ветки по очереди?

Andrey
13.02.2017
11:34:31
нодоболь

Illya
13.02.2017
11:35:25

Андрей
13.02.2017
11:35:56
блин..

Illya
13.02.2017
11:36:38
так же как вы бы это на PHP делали
дано nested sets, превратить его во вложенные объекты

Андрей
13.02.2017
11:39:11

Google

Андрей
13.02.2017
11:39:21
там в json вложенные объекты
там не строки готовые с разметкой

Illya
13.02.2017
11:39:47
да, но они лежат ПЛОСКИМ массивом
в то время как в реальности это на самом деле ДЕРЕВО

Андрей
13.02.2017
11:40:06
ага! теперь начинаем понимать )

Illya
13.02.2017
11:42:51
эх, прийдется писать >__<
@webgr https://jsfiddle.net/s313zhr0/
там и преобразование дерева в нужный формат и вывод

Андрей
13.02.2017
11:51:47

Illya
13.02.2017
11:54:44
а я тем временем добавил еще два задания в мой базовый курс: преобразование в nested sets и обратно

Andrey
13.02.2017
11:54:50

Illya
13.02.2017
11:55:10
просто сэмулировать что типа оно аяксом грузится

Sergey
13.02.2017
11:55:10
@xanf_ua посмотрел Вашу открытую лекцию про vue недавно. A не можете подсказать, может есть ссылка на какой-нибудь открытый проект, хотелось бы посмотреть структуру проекта и как все вязалось со vuex? если есть возможность, был бы очень признателен

Illya
13.02.2017
11:55:18
не подскажу

Ilya
13.02.2017
11:55:42
он гуру вью

Sergey
13.02.2017
11:56:02
спасибо большое)

Illya
13.02.2017
11:56:08
А я пойду во вражеский стан
писать заявку на React Amsterdam :)

Ilya
13.02.2017
11:56:44
спасибо большое)
можешь даже контрибутить, он довольно общительный и помогает, если есть какие-то траблы

Google

Sergey
13.02.2017
11:57:15

MVP
13.02.2017
12:00:24
все посмотрели уже ? - https://github.com/pablohpsilva/vuejs-component-style-guide
наскольуо реалистичные и/или полезные требования по вашему?

Stanislav
13.02.2017
12:01:24
Да, только, я не понимаю, почему это называется style guide, а не code style.

MVP
13.02.2017
12:02:24
да кстати
с названиями вообще у людей часто беда, например называют статью об основах использования чего-либо "X cheatsheet ". может это занудно но cheatsheet - это грубо по русски "шпора", что-то компактно перечисляющее суть, главные методы и тд

Stanislav
13.02.2017
12:04:10
Но у меня, если честно, еще руки не дошли почитать про что там ?

Sergey
13.02.2017
12:05:50
у меня наверное реакт головного мозга, но как-то синтаксис без vue-class-component не особо приятен

Illya
13.02.2017
12:35:52
Все норм
Мне тоже не нравится
Но я понимаю почему так
И у меня претензия не только к виду

Illya
13.02.2017
12:37:25
Вью задуман чтоб он работал без транспайлеров
Поэтому обошлись без классов

Rafkat
13.02.2017
12:41:50
Идея для vue3?

Михаил
13.02.2017
12:43:56
можно же было просто в vue-cli сделать какой-то билд через vue-class-component и все

Illya
13.02.2017
12:47:22
Зачем
Кому надо тот сам вкрутит
Тем более если не брать тайпскрипт там все очень плохо
Не надо пока это стандартизировать

Google

Sergey
13.02.2017
12:49:26
насколько плохо без ts? я вот хотел взять его + flow

Illya
13.02.2017
12:51:44
Я так использую
Все норм
Проблема в декораторах
Фундаментальная

Andrey
13.02.2017
12:52:54
Флов и тс разве не решают одну и ту же задачу?

Владимир???
13.02.2017
12:54:47

Stanislav
13.02.2017
12:57:14
почему должно быть наоборот?
Насколько я знаю, style guide - это про размеры\цвета\использование формачек, кнопочек и т.д. В общем, описание где и как строить\использовать элементы интерфейса

Illya
13.02.2017
12:57:24

Admin
ERROR: S client not available

Sergey
13.02.2017
12:57:36
а миксинами по vue пользуется кто? или как в реакте от них отказываются?

Illya
13.02.2017
12:57:51
Один решает, второй делает вид что решает (продолжаю нагло хайпить flow)

MVP
13.02.2017
13:16:01

Illya
13.02.2017
13:16:16
в смысле?

MVP
13.02.2017
13:17:53
в смысле?
ну ты знаешь что react бесплатен и доступен для всех пока Facebook Inc. не решит что ты или твоя компания с ними конкурирует.

Illya
13.02.2017
13:18:06
нет, с флоу не так )
BSD License
For Flow software

MVP
13.02.2017
13:19:16

Oleh
13.02.2017
13:35:06
ребята, хочу задать дефолтные какие то данные
var notes = Array(3);
notes.map(function(item) {
console.log("test")
item = {
id: i,
title: "Title Test",
msg: "message for test"
};
});
но не ботает, почему то
сылка теряется да?

Google

Oleh
13.02.2017
13:35:55
пробовал так же свойство добавлять, но не получилось
как правильно?

MVP
13.02.2017
13:41:08
надо в функции return item; делать

Oleh
13.02.2017
13:49:43
понял)
спасибо)

Stanislav
13.02.2017
14:03:39
>How to embed Vue.js & Vuex inside an AngularJS app
?

MVP
13.02.2017
14:04:30

Stanislav
13.02.2017
14:04:55
https://medium.com/the-cushion-journal/how-to-embed-vue-js-vuex-inside-an-angularjs-app-wait-what-e10c9aa812a7#.ma8iq750a

MVP
13.02.2017
14:06:03
это помните такая картинка лет 10 назад была - типо freeBSD запущена внутири macOS внутри винды и типо - "парни, кто знает почему звук не работает?"

Vlad
13.02.2017
14:07:05

Oleh
13.02.2017
14:38:28
тикните в меня ссылкой плс, где описано как вызывать событие у родителя
листаю доку не могу найти

Semen
13.02.2017
14:42:49
мб emit?

Oleh
13.02.2017
14:45:28
мб emit?
да, наверное, примеры вот норм ищу

Illya
13.02.2017
14:52:03
Не уверен что так можно без parent
Противоречит однонаправленному data flow

Oleh
13.02.2017
14:52:30
vm.$on('test', function (msg) {
console.log(msg)
})
vm.$emit('test', 'hi')
// -> "hi"
я так понял что нету разници где я подписался, да? могу хоть в потомке
или только в иерархическом порятке? (для понимания)

Boris
13.02.2017
14:52:49
данные вниз, события вверх

Oleh
13.02.2017
14:53:47
но если сделаю наоборот тоже будет работать, да? (знаю что не правильно, для понимания)
и могу подписатся в абсолютно разных и не связаных между собой вюшках, да?